Survey of Semantic Description of REST APIs
The REST architectural style assumes that client and server form a contract with content negotiation, not only on the data format but implicitly also on the semantics of the communicated data, i.e., an agreement on how the data have to be interpreted. In different application scenarios such an agreement requires vendor-specific content types for the individual services to convey the meaning of the communicated data. The idea behind vendor-specific content types is that service providers can reuse content types and service consumers can make use of specific processors for the individual content types. In practice however, we see that many RESTful APIs on the Web simply make use of standard non-specific content types, e.g., text/
full text BibTeX other citation formats
Published in 2014 in REST: Advanced Research Topics and Practical Applications.
- Web
- reuse
- REST
- content negotiation
Read this chapter online
- Read the full text online.
- Request a digital copy of this chapter.
- Comment on this chapter.
Cite this chapter in your work
Cite this chapter easily using its BibTeX entry:
@incollection{verborgh_rest_2014,
title = {Survey of Semantic Description of {REST APIs}},
author = {Verborgh, Ruben and Harth, Andreas and Maleshkova, Maria and Stadtm\"uller, Steffen and Steiner, Thomas and Taheriyan, Mohsen and Van de Walle, Rik},
year = 2014,
booktitle = {REST: Advanced Research Topics and Practical Applications},
editor = {Pautasso, Cesare and Wilde, Erik and Alarcón, Rosa},
pages = {69--89},
publisher = {Springer},
isbn = {978-1-4614-9298-6},
url = {http://link.springer.com/chapter/10.1007/978-1-4614-9299-3_5},
}
Alternatively, pick a reference of your choice below:
- ACM
- Ruben Verborgh, Andreas Harth, Maria Maleshkova, Steffen Stadtmüller, Thomas Steiner, Mohsen Taheriyan, and Rik Van de Walle. 2014. Survey of Semantic Description of REST APIs. In REST: Advanced Research Topics and Practical Applications, Cesare Pautasso, Erik Wilde and Rosa Alarcón (eds.). Springer, 69–89.
- APA
- Verborgh, R., Harth, A., Maleshkova, M., Stadtmüller, S., Steiner, T., Taheriyan, M., & Van de Walle, R. (2014). Survey of Semantic Description of REST APIs. In C. Pautasso, E. Wilde, & R. Alarcón (Eds.), REST: Advanced Research Topics and Practical Applications (pp. 69–89). Springer.
- IEEE
- R. Verborgh et al., “Survey of Semantic Description of REST APIs,” in REST: Advanced Research Topics and Practical Applications, C. Pautasso, E. Wilde, and R. Alarcón, Eds. Springer, 2014, pp. 69–89.
- LNCS
- Verborgh, R., Harth, A., Maleshkova, M., Stadtmüller, S., Steiner, T., Taheriyan, M., Van de Walle, R.: Survey of Semantic Description of REST APIs. In: Pautasso, C., Wilde, E., and Alarcón, R. (eds.) REST: Advanced Research Topics and Practical Applications. pp. 69–89. Springer (2014).
- MLA
- Verborgh, Ruben, et al. “Survey of Semantic Description of REST APIs.” REST: Advanced Research Topics and Practical Applications, edited by Cesare Pautasso et al., Springer, 2014, pp. 69–89.
Discuss this chapter
- Discover all publications by Ruben Verborgh.
- Find related articles on Google Scholar.
- Post your questions or comments below.